The CommBank Small Business Banking team have a passion for helping Australian small businesses succeed.
The team seek to understand the business and personal goals of business owners and use their expertise and specialist teams to provide tailored financial solutions.
Our State Business Banking QLD team is a part of Small Business Banking and provides remote support to Small Businesses across QLDDo work that matters:
We are looking for a commercial lender to join Brisbane State based team
Be part of a high performing team and contribute to its success by providing exceptional service to Small Business customers through understanding their business and personal needs and assisting them with the end-to-end fulfilment of those needs
As a Business Banker, you will be accountable for writing commercial lending deals up to $1m
Hybrid Working Available.
As our Small Business Banker, you will:
- Facilitate great customer conversations that help to understand their goals and needs and provide relevant and timely solutions. This will include the origination of a range of solutions for businesses including, but not limited to, commercial lending up to $1M, asset finance, home loans and merchant facilities
- Proactively engage customers to support their business and personal goals. Prepare for customer conversations with a view to providing valuable insights. You have an understanding of the home ownership solutions available to business customers.
We want to hear from you if you have:
- Experience in commercial lending
- Experience in sourcing clients from referral partners within the bank or external referral partners like brokers, accountants
- Excellent time management skills
- Sound financial analysis skills and business banking acumen
- Excellent interpersonal skills and stakeholder engagement/management skills
- Excellent customer engagement skills
- Experience in facilitating conversations with customers to help understand their needs, managing a pipeline of opportunities to ensure we meet customers' expectations and in facilitating proactive customer contact
- Passion for Small Business customers or experience in or managing a Small Business
- FSRA Tier 2 Accreditation, or able to obtain this within first 30 days
- Credit Approval Authority (CAA) Level 1 or willing to obtain this within 6 months
